Output 96be882454f8c422de456388d304256a2275a36ecdb3c67d93d074daf8b891a6:0

value
289667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40406743868ef3389d85c491489749fe99d53cfa OP_EQUALVERIFY OP_CHECKSIG
address
16rjQ6vE4ms3r74uc9rzCPST97KQs9pKAH
transaction
96be882454f8c422de456388d304256a2275a36ecdb3c67d93d074daf8b891a6
spent
true